Originally a Cumbrian farm, now a well-presented holiday village with lots of traditional character, cobbled streets between natural stone buildings, a duck pond, and views towards the fells. A range of onsite facilities including a swimming pool, jacuzzi, sauna, steam room, gym and games room. Visit Ullswater (9 miles), take a steamboat trip or walk to the waterfalls at Aira Force. The charming town of Keswick (11 miles) has a nice selection of pubs, restaurants, and independent shops to explore. The annual Mountain Festival is held over three days here, with world-class sports, and talks, films, and live music events taking place beside the lake. At Whinlatter Forest (15 miles) kids will love the Gruffalo trail, or if you enjoy mountain biking there are some great tracks to explore. Rookin House Activity Centre is 4 miles away offering a huge selection of activities including Go Karting, Horse riding and paint balling.

As you enter the property into the lobby, you will find space to hang up your coats and there is a handy WC. The bright open-plan lounge/kitchen/diner is a lovely social space in which to relax together. The kitchen has a gas hob and oven, microwave, dishwasher, and fridge/freezer. Off the kitchen, there is a large dining table for all the family to gather around, enjoy breakfast or a nice evening meal while discussing plans for the next day. There are comfortable sofas to seat all guests in the lounge area with TV, board games, and access out onto the private terrace. The staircase leads off the lounge up to the first floor. There is a double master bedroom with an en-suite shower room and WC. The bedroom has direct access out onto a private balcony, it offers seating to relax with a coffee or a good book. Next door there is a cosy bunk bedroom, and across the hallway there is a bathroom with a shower over the bath and a WC, and the third room is a lovely twin bedroom.
There are lots of onsite facilities to enjoy: the café bar, restaurant and clubhouse, an indoor heated pool, sauna, steam room, gym, crazy golf, pitch and putt, giant chess and adventure playground. The property has a private balcony and a small terrace to sit out and watch the world go by. There is a large car park at the rear of the property with ample parking.
